Mid Pines Golf & Country Club - Southern Pines, NC Mid Pines is a Donald Ross golf course that is part of the Pine Needles/Mid Pines Resort.  The course is open to the public year round.  It is located in Southern Pines, just 5 miles from Pinehurst and right across the road from its more famous sibling Pine Needles.  The Mid Pines course reminds you a lot of Augusta National.  Obviously, it is not as long or quite as scenic, but the topography, the pine trees and the azaleas sure do make you miss those rare visits to the Masters.  The course is challenging, but it is the most accessible of the world class Donald Ross courses in the area that is meticulously maintained.  Rates, including cart, range from about $130 in the off season to $180 in high season, so this is definitely not an ev...
